How Do You Convert Liters to Quarts?
Multiply the number of liters by 1.05669 to get US liquid quarts. The formula is: Quarts = Liters x 1.05669. To convert back from quarts to liters, divide by 1.05669 or multiply by 0.94635. This conversion uses the US liquid quart, which is the standard in the United States.

Common Liter to Quart Conversions
| Liters | US Quarts | Context |
|---|---|---|
| 0.5 L | 0.528 qt | Small bottle |
| 1 L | 1.057 qt | Standard metric bottle |
| 1.5 L | 1.585 qt | Large wine bottle (magnum) |
| 2 L | 2.113 qt | Soda bottle |
| 3 L | 3.170 qt | Large juice container |
| 4 L | 4.227 qt | Box wine |
| 5 L | 5.283 qt | Cooking oil tin |
| 8 L | 8.454 qt | Large stock pot |
| 10 L | 10.567 qt | Commercial kitchen container |
| 20 L | 21.134 qt | Water cooler jug |

Automotive and Maintenance
Engine oil capacity, coolant, and transmission fluid are specified in quarts in the US and liters elsewhere. A European car manual stating 4.5 liters of oil translates to 4.5 x 1.057 = 4.755 quarts, which is just under 5 quarts. Science and Lab Work
Laboratory procedures outside the US use liters exclusively, while some American lab suppliers sell reagents in quart bottles. Converting between the two prevents measurement errors that could ruin an experiment. A 2.5-liter solution equals 2.642 quarts, not a clean number, so careful measuring matters.
